Courses from 1000+ universities
Buried in Coursera’s 300-page prospectus: two failed merger attempts, competing bidders, a rogue shareholder, and a combined market cap that shrank from $3.8 billion to $1.7 billion.
600 Free Google Certifications
Psychology
Information Technology
Digital Marketing
AP® Microeconomics
Let's Get Started: Building Self-Awareness
Dino 101: Dinosaur Paleobiology
Organize and share your learning with Class Central Lists.
View our Lists Showcase
Learn to build an authenticated API using FastAPI and token-based authentication. Covers project setup, user authentication, password hashing, access token creation, and token authorization testing.
Learn to build a scalable Dropbox-like website using Node.js and Linode's Object Storage. Step-by-step guide covers server setup, file operations, UI creation, and styling for a powerful, affordable file storage solution.
Learn to implement offset-based pagination in a Remix project using Prisma and SQL, enhancing performance and user experience for large datasets. Covers database queries, UI controls, and accessibility.
Comprehensive tutorial on building a fast, responsive blog using Next.js, covering installation, app creation, routing, and working with slugs and titles in just one hour.
Comprehensive guide to using DNF package manager in Linux, covering installation, searching, updating, and removing packages, as well as automating updates and managing dependencies.
Comprehensive beginner's guide to Python programming, covering essential concepts from installation to object-oriented programming with hands-on examples and practical demonstrations.
Explore memory forensics with Volatility in this hands-on tutorial. Learn to analyze system crashes, identify hidden processes, extract crucial information, and enhance your incident response skills.
Learn disk analysis using Autopsy, a digital forensics platform. Explore data sources, artifacts, and timelines for effective computer investigations. Gain practical skills in digital forensics and cybersecurity.
Learn to build and deploy a Django REST Framework API on Linode, covering project setup, database configuration, API development, and deployment to a Linux server with a managed PostgreSQL database.
Learn to set up and configure an NFS server and client on Linux, including auto-mounting with AutoFS for on-demand access and improved control over network file systems.
Learn to build a video streaming platform using HTML, CSS, and Next.js. Covers creating components, integrating Linode Object Storage, and implementing video upload and playback functionalities.
Learn to install, configure, and use Suricata for intrusion detection. Covers IDS, IPS, network security monitoring, custom rules, log analysis, and integration with Wazuh for enhanced Blue Team cybersecurity.
Learn to implement dynamic route parameters in Remix, query specific database entries with Prisma, and create a UI for reading and updating pet information in a PostgreSQL database.
Learn to implement CRUD operations using Remix and Prisma, focusing on data submission, form handling, validation, and database integration for building robust web applications.
Build a full-stack note-taking app from scratch using HTML, CSS, JavaScript, and Node.js. Learn database integration, user authentication, and CRUD operations for a functional web application.
Get personalized course recommendations, track subjects and courses with reminders, and more.